Whose Life Is It Anyway? starring Richard Dreyfuss, John Cassavetes, Christine Lahti, Bob Balaban has a R rating, a runtime of about 1 hr 59 min. The release date of the movie is December 2nd, 1981. The movie received a user score of 71/100 on TMDb, which is derived from reviews from 45 engaged users.
Want the short version of the plot? Here's the plot: "Ken Harrison is an artist that lives to make sculptures. One day he is involved in a car accident, and is paralyzed from his neck down. All he can do is talk and move his head, and he wants to die. Whilst he is in hospital he makes friends with some of the staff, and they support him when he goes to trial to be allowed to die."
